Prussian Blue #022953 Color Blind Simulation

Colour blind people face many difficulties in everyday life which normally sighted people just aren’t aware of. Problems can arise in even the simplest of activities including choosing and preparing food, gardening, sport, driving a car and selecting which clothes to wear. Colour blind people can also find themselves in trouble because they haven’t been able to pick up a change in someone’s mood by a change in colour of their face, or not noticed their child getting sunburnt. Prussian Blue #022953 Color Conversion

Here's a color conversion chart. It contains technical information about the hex color #022953.

hex
#022953
web safe
#003366
rgb
2 , 41 , 83
rgb percentage
1 , 16 , 33
cmyk
98 , 51 , 0 , 67
hsl
211 , 95 , 17
hsv
211 , 98 , 33
binary
10 , 101001 , 1010011
lab
16.62 , 5.67 , -29.20
ncol
C52 , 1 , 68
xyz
11.9458 , 14.0146 , 32.8631
hwb
211 , 1,68
decimal
5449986
